The economic crisis and its consequences on the EU have enhanced cultural and nationalist closures across Europe, characterized by a rise of political extremes, xenophobia and racism. The results of the last European elections were characterized as such by a significant rise of nationalist parties and a strong abstention. In this context, the project "Made in Europe" aims to engage a shared reflection on identity and European citizenship in order to promote mutual understanding and harmonious live-together among different cultures in particular taking into account the populations of extra European immigrations. The project will take place in Evry, Ile-de-France from 26th to 29th March 2014 and will gatherc young people aged 18-25 from 4 European countries, representing 8 towns and one organization of youth councils. The territory of the french “agglomeration” of Evry Centre Essonne can be a relevant and best example to address those problems and to contribute to the development of a strong European citizenship among the young in accordance with the specific features of the Europe of today. Indeed, 4 places of worship (Muslims, Catholics, Protestants, and Buddhists) and more than 70 nationalities are present in the area. Several important events are scheduled: after a friendly welcome meal shared with local authorities, participants will be mobilized within aninternational mobility forum, a debate on the issue of European cultural identity with the participation of political, scientific and associative experts, a seminar which will be dealt with the issue of inclusion of diversity in the construction of European citizenship and finally a multicultural evening show in which will be given the Youth Pass participants. A relaxing day will be dedicated to the visit of Evry Centre Essonne and to informal youth exchanges. By confronting the youth to other cultural realities, the project "Made in Europe" has the ambition to contribute to the fight against all forms of discrimination, to promote the active participation of young people in society and in discussion with decision-makers and finally to develop cross-disciplinary skills and soft skills among young people so that they are more willing to future geographical and professional mobility, for better employability.
